How to cook dumplings from cottage cheese. How to cook classic dumplings with cottage cheese

Ingredients:

  • milk - 500 milliliters;
  • chicken eggs - 2 pieces;
  • sugar - 1 teaspoon;
  • salt - ⅓ teaspoons;
  • flour - 750 grams (you may need more or less);

For filling:

  • cottage cheese - 400 grams;
  • sugar - 3 tablespoons;
  • melted butter and sour cream for serving.

The most delicious dumplings with cheese. Step by step recipe

  1. Let's start cooking delicious and tender choux pastry on milk. To do this, beat two eggs, salt, sugar and 500 milliliters of milk into a saucepan. We take a saucepan, because later we will brew everything in it on the stove. Mix everything thoroughly with a whisk until it has a homogeneous consistency.
  2. Now add the sifted flour one spoon at a time. Make sure that no lumps form. Mix everything thoroughly. We bring our mass to a consistency - like pancake dough.
  3. Now put the pan on the stove and cook our choux pastry over medium heat until thickened. Do not leave the stove, stir with a whisk without stopping. When you feel the dough has thickened, remove it and transfer the pan to a work surface. If it turns out that there are small lumps in the dough, don’t worry, they will disperse during kneading.
  4. While the dough is still very liquid, mix it in a saucepan using a whisk. When it thickens, we transfer it to the work surface, where we will knead the choux pastry for dumplings by hand.
  5. Since the dough is very sticky, it is impossible to knead it with your hands - you need to pour a pile of flour on the table, lay out the dough, sprinkle more flour on top. And at the first stage, select the thickness of the dough. The dough will be very warm, but not scalding. Therefore, it is pleasant to knead it: it is very alive.
  6. When the dough becomes thick enough, begin adding flour in very small portions. Until we get a smooth, soft dough that does not stick to our hands.
  7. You can also check how well your dough is kneaded. To do this, place it on a clean table and press down firmly - the dough should not stick to either the table or your hands. Also cut a piece of dough and look at the cut: it should be uniform. The dough should cut well and not drag on the knife blade.
  8. Now we collect the dough, round it, cover it and leave it to rest for 20 minutes.
  9. While the dough is resting, we will prepare the curd filling. I don't recommend cooking it in advance as it will become soggy. It is collected immediately before making dumplings. The cottage cheese should preferably be dry. If you have very wet cottage cheese, place it on cheesecloth the day before. I prefer to add only sugar to the cottage cheese. This is what my mother did - and it was very gentle. But you can add both an egg and sour cream: the main thing is to make sure that the filling is not liquid.
  10. I really like to cook dumplings, dumplings, manti with choux pastry. Because paste is able to retain more moisture than flour, and therefore the dough turns out moister - but at the same time it holds its shape, is viscous and rolls out perfectly. This dough can be boiled, baked, fried - whatever you want.
  11. Once the dough has stood, you can start rolling out and making dumplings filled with cottage cheese. Roll out a small piece of dough to a thin layer.
  12. Using a glass or mug, cut out circles from the dough (the size of the dumplings). We collect the remaining dough and put it aside.
  13. Now put a little curd filling on each circle (in the middle). Next we take and make dumplings: in the most ordinary way. Just take and connect the edges. Then we bend the first extreme corner at an angle and then bend the second one at the same angle? And so, overlapping, along the entire length. Like this in a simple way we get a beautiful braid on the dumpling. The dough is very pliable and very easy to mold. Make sure that the cottage cheese does not get on the joint between the edges of the dough, help yourself with your finger and slightly deepen the cottage cheese into the middle of the dumpling. This is how we make all the other dumplings.
  14. Some of the dumplings can be put into bags and put in the freezer. This is how you will always have it quick breakfast, lunch or dinner.
  15. Next, to boil them, take a pan of water, put it on the fire, add salt. When the water boils, do not reduce the heat, but carefully throw the dumplings into the pan. Take a slotted spoon and stir so they don't stick to the bottom. And when all the dumplings rise to the top (float), let them cook for 2 minutes. And you can take it out using a slotted spoon.

It will be amazingly delicious if you serve dumplings with cottage cheese with sour cream, pouring melted butter. 3 secrets of delicious curd filling

  1. The most important secret is, of course, high-quality cottage cheese. It should be fatty, crumbly and well pressed, have a soft and uniform consistency and not be too sour in taste. Low-fat curds and curd masses or curd products should not be used, because when mixed with salt or sugar, the filling becomes too liquid, and the dumplings begin to fall apart during the cooking process.
  2. If you want the filling to be very tender, melting in your mouth, beat the cottage cheese with a blender or rub through a sieve 3 times.
  3. If the cottage cheese seems too dry, add one tablespoon of heavy cream to it.

Sweet filling with dried berries

The finished products are extremely tasty and nutritious - thanks to the amazing harmonious combination cottage cheese and dried berries.

Ingredients:

  • 500 g cottage cheese;
  • 1 egg;
  • 40 g dried cranberries;
  • 40 g dried cherries;
  • 5 tbsp. l. Sahara;
  • vanillin (optional).

Preparation:

  1. Soak dry berries in boiling water for 5 minutes and place them in a colander to drain the water, or even better, then place them on a paper towel so that it completely absorbs the remaining liquid on the fruits. This is necessary so that the filling is thick enough, otherwise the dumplings may fall apart during cooking and all the filling will leak out.
  2. Add soft berries to the ground or mashed cottage cheese with a fork and mix everything well.
  3. Separately, beat the egg with sugar and vanilla. Beat for at least 5 minutes to form a strong foam. Add the beaten egg to the cottage cheese, mix again and form dumplings.

Filling for dumplings from cottage cheese with herbs

These dumplings are perfect for those who are watching their figure or don’t like sweets. The greens in the filling add ready-made dish amazing aroma and spicy taste.

Ingredients:

  • 500 g cottage cheese;
  • 2 cloves of garlic;
  • a small bunch of parsley and dill;
  • salt.

Preparation:

  1. Squeeze the cottage cheese well to remove excess whey (if this is not done, the dumplings will fall apart during cooking), and grind with a blender. The filling mixture should be homogeneous.
  2. Stir chopped herbs and garlic through a press into the cottage cheese, add salt.
  3. Mix everything thoroughly and add to the dough for dumplings.

Selection of ingredients

Choose cottage cheese for dumplings with medium fat content (9%) or full-fat homemade cottage cheese. Both are ideal, depending on your taste.

If you choose cottage cheese at the market, try it. It should not be sour or bitter, otherwise the filling will turn out tasteless. High-quality cottage cheese smells pleasant and does not separate. It has a soft buttery consistency. Color: white-cream. When choosing cottage cheese in a store, check the expiration date.

Buy only natural product. IN curd products and there is a lot in the curd mass various additives, which make the product cheaper, but do not make it healthier.

Delicious dumplings with cottage cheese recipe step by step

  1. First, let's prepare the “correct” dough. Pour the flour into a deep bowl, add a pinch of salt and a glass of warm water.

  2. Knead the dough and knead it with your hands for at least five minutes. The dough turns out quite tight. But don't be scared and spare no effort. Delicious dumplings are worth it. When your dough is ready, it will resemble plasticine in structure. Cover it with a kitchen towel and leave to “rest” for half an hour.

  3. For now, get to work preparing the filling. Curd filling For dumplings we will have savory. Place the cottage cheese in a separate bowl, beat in the egg and add a little salt.
  4. Mash the cottage cheese thoroughly and mix well until smooth. The filling is ready.

  5. Cut 1/3 of the dough and roll it out thin pancake. The thinner it turns out, the tastier your dumplings will be.
  6. Take a glass or cup and cut out circles from the dough. This way, all your dumplings will be the same size. Discard excess dough (crumple it and use it when you make the next batch of dumplings).

  7. Use a teaspoon to take a little filling, place it in the center of the circle and pinch the edges with your fingers. Pinch carefully so that the dumpling does not fall apart in the water.

  8. Take a saucepan, pour in a little more than half of the water, add salt (half a tablespoon of salt) and put it on the fire to boil.

  9. Drop the dumplings, one at a time, into the boiling water. After a minute, stir with a spoon.
  10. When the dumplings float to the surface, boil them for another five minutes.

  11. Remove the finished dumplings with a slotted spoon and transfer to a deep plate.

  12. Melt the butter in the microwave or on the stove and pour the butter over the hot dumplings. Stir.


    If the dumplings are not immediately poured with oil, they will stick together.

Serve hot.

With 1/3 of the dough I get about 13-14 dumplings. If this amount is enough for you, then put the rest of the dough in a bag and store it in the refrigerator. If you need to make four or five servings, roll out all the dough, shape the dumplings, and then cook in batches. Ready dumplings can be stored in the freezer.

What do dumplings with cottage cheese eat with?

Traditionally, unsweetened curd dumplings are poured with butter and eaten with sour cream. Ideally it's delicious homemade sour cream. Can be served with cream - also a very good option.

On sour cream base If desired, you can prepare a wide variety of sauces. For example: finely chop the dill, chop the garlic or pass it through a press and mix with sour cream. Add salt and pepper and the sauce is ready.

Another option: make a cross-shaped cut on the tomato, lower the tomato into boiling water, remove it and immediately lower it into cold water. Peel the tomato and chop it with a knife. Add to sour cream, salt and pepper. You can add finely chopped cilantro and garlic.

More dumplings from unsweetened cottage cheese can be served with natural yoghurt or yogurt-based sauce. You can prepare it simply and tasty like this: grate the pickled cucumber on a coarse grater, pass a couple of cloves of garlic through a press, and finely chop the greens. Mix with yogurt. Season with pepper and serve with dumplings.

Dough for dumplings can also be prepared with milk, kefir or whey. Some people add an egg to the dough (one or two for the same amount of flour as in my recipe).

For filling unsweetened cottage cheese dumplings you can add chopped herbs. Some people prefer to add sour cream to the filling. I think that this is not a very good idea, since it is more difficult to make dumplings with sour cream in the filling. Due to the fat present in sour cream, the dumplings fall apart during cooking. In my opinion, an egg is enough.

If you want to make sweet dumplings with cottage cheese, instead of salt, add sugar to your taste. If you like the filling not too sweet, 3-4 tablespoons of sugar will be enough. Do you like it sweeter? Then feel free to put five. You can add a drop of vanilla or vanilla sugar to the filling for sweet dumplings with cottage cheese, as well as raisins, dried apricots, prunes, and nut crumbs.

Dumplings with cottage cheese are also prepared by steaming. This is what my mom always does. Dumplings prepared in this way are very different from those in my recipe. The pleasant viscosity of the cooked dough disappears. Steamed dumplings turn out very fluffy. I prefer boiled ones. Which cooking method to choose is up to you. It's a matter of taste.

I don’t give the exact amount of flour, because kefir comes in different thicknesses depending on the % fat content, eggs different sizes. 🙂 As a result, it is simply impossible to guess exactly how much flour will be used.

Moreover, “taste and color...”, everyone likes it different dough, you can adjust it more abruptly or softly to suit yourself. But I don’t recommend making the dough too tight; after all, we’re not rolling noodles.

The dough according to this recipe turns out to be very soft and tender, again, if you do not overdo it with flour: as soon as it stops sticking to your hands and does not stick to the rolling pin when rolling out, then that’s enough. This dough can be used to make dumplings with any filling.

Step 6. Roll out the layer into the shape of a large pancake.

Step 7. In the rolled out layer, carefully squeeze out round pieces with a glass. First coat the edges of the glass with flour to prevent the dough from sticking.

Step 8. Use a small spoon to add cottage cheese to each circle. I understand your desire to put more cottage cheese, it will be tastier (I’m the same). But do not forget that the edges should stick well to each other, so that later during cooking the cottage cheese does not end up in the pan, so be reasonable.

Step 9. We fold our circle in half, it turns out to be a semicircle, with the cottage cheese in the middle. We connect the edges and, using fairly strong pressure, fasten them together along the entire semicircle. Then roll the entire flat area of ​​the dough into a braid.

This is done simply: start from the end and, as if folding the edge of the dough in half, press it with the outside of your thumb at an angle of 45˚. Move around the circle to the other end. My grandmother taught me how to “braid” a pigtail on dumplings when I was 6 years old. First I practiced on plasticine, and then she trusted me with the dough. And to better understand this technology, just watch the video (below).

And the most pleasant final stage:

Throw the finished dumplings with cottage cheese into boiling salted water, cook for 5 minutes after floating, remove with a slotted spoon to a plate, grease with butter and sprinkle with sugar. They can also be served with sour cream or jam, such as strawberry or .

The result was delicious dumplings. The recipe is very simple and affordable. By the way, in the recipe for dumplings, just like in mine, I used premium flour.

Vareniki, which you see on the plate and a few more behind the scenes, were made from half the dough and 2.5 store-bought packs of cottage cheese (180 grams each).

Place the remaining dumplings on a tray and put them in the freezer. After they are frozen, place them in a plastic bag and tie them so that the dough does not absorb the odors of other products stored in the container. freezer. Frozen dumplings with cottage cheese need to be cooked for at least 10 minutes, otherwise you risk eating half-baked dough.
